Avancis stops production in Torgau: 162 jobs in danger!
Torgau. A shock for the region! Avancis, the manufacturer colorful high-tech solar modules, announces the setting of production at the Torgau location! In the coming weeks, the production of the popular solar modules, which were previously known for their striking aesthetics, will be discontinued. Of the currently 162 employees, including almost 100 in production, many are affected by the termination. Managing Director Helmut Frankenberger blames the exorbitant increased prices for industrial stream. Production in Germany is simply no longer profitable!
The employees have already been informed about the decision of the parent company China National Building Materials (CNBM) last week. In the future, the solar modules from China will be delivered. The future of the jobs is uncertain, but HR manager Guido Lehmann and production manager Iris Didschuns emphasize that discussions with the works council are already running about possible severance payments and social plans. Trainees are not affected by the closure - a little ray of hope in this dark situation.
One of the reasons: Expensive industrial flow
The decision to cease production is bitter, but the Torgau location should continue to exist. Although the modules are no longer manufactured here, the administration and the color finishing remains on site. Avancis plans to use the new coating in Munich as part of a pilot line for color finishing, which is suitable for both CIGS and silicon modules. While the Torgau location is considered important, the question remains how many jobs will ultimately be lost. The solar industry is highly competitive, and Avancis now has to reorient itself in order to survive in this difficult market.
The colorful solar modules from Torgau enjoy great popularity among architects and builders. But the increasing production costs have heavily burdened the company. Avancis was founded in 2006 and has been part of the Chinese state company CNBM since 2014. With the closure of the production in Torgau, a chapter in the history of solar technology is closed, while the industry continues to fight for the best solutions.
